Workshop Boilermaker M2P Engineering Salisbury, QLD Up to $2400+ per week on a 50hr week Permanent At M2P Engineering, we pride ourselves on delivering high-quality engineering and construction solutions. As a Workshop Boilermaker, you will play a critical role in fabricating and assembling metal structures, ensuring that our projects meet the highest standards of quality and safety. Based in Salisbury, QLD, you will work in our well-equipped workshop, contributing to a variety of projects across different sectors, including mining, industrial, and marine. You’ll make an impact by: Fabricating, assembling, and repairing metal structures and components Utilising your knowledge of GMAW (flux core) and GTAW welding processes Fabricating a variety of heavy industrial pipework, platework, and structural steel Reading and interpreting technical drawings and blueprints Working with a variety of materials including stainless steel, carbon steel, aluminium, and exotics Ensuring all work meets quality and safety standards What you’ll bring To succeed in this role, you will have: Trade qualification as a Boilermaker Proficiency in various welding techniques, including MIG, TIG, GMAW (flux core), and GTAW Strong ability to read and interpret technical drawings Experience in fabricating heavy industrial pipework, platework, and structural steel Commitment to safety and attention to detail Ideally, you will also have: Experience in a workshop environment, particularly within the mining, industrial, or marine sectors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to work independently A flexible attitude and willingness to take on a variety of tasks as needed Why M2P Engineering?
